At its core, the 2021 CMPack was built to maximize the aging 1.8.9 architecture. By integrating optimized versions of OptiFine and custom memory management patches, the client provided a noticeable stability increase on mid-range hardware. In a competitive environment where "frame drops" can determine the outcome of a duel, CMPack’s ability to maintain high FPS during intensive particle effects (such as critical hits or potion splashes) made it a reliable choice for players on servers like Hypixel.
